Obstetric embolism (O88)

The ICD-10 code section O88 covers various types of obstetric embolism, which are serious complications involving emboli such as air, amniotic fluid, thrombi, or infectious material that occur during pregnancy, childbirth, or the postpartum period.

This code group helps healthcare providers precisely classify and document different embolic events specific to obstetrics, including obstetric air embolism (O88.0), amniotic fluid embolism (O88.1), thromboembolism (O88.2), and pyemic and septic embolism (O88.3). Each subtype can be further specified by trimester, childbirth, or puerperium timing. For example, terms like “obstetrical air embolism,” “amniotic fluid pulmonary embolism,” and “pulmonary embolism in childbirth” directly map to these codes. This detailed breakdown guides coders in assigning the proper ICD-10 code for conditions such as arterial air embolus, complications from amniotic fluid entering maternal circulation, blood clots affecting pregnancy stages, and septic emboli linked to infections during pregnancy or postpartum. Using these codes accurately supports clinical clarity and appropriate care management for these rare but critical obstetric emergencies.

Instructional Notations

Type 1 Excludes

A type 1 excludes note is a pure excludes note. It means "NOT CODED HERE!" An Excludes1 note indicates that the code excluded should never be used at the same time as the code above the Excludes1 note. An Excludes1 is used when two conditions cannot occur together, such as a congenital form versus an acquired form of the same condition.

  • embolism complicating abortion NOS O03.2
  • embolism complicating ectopic or molar pregnancy O08.2
  • embolism complicating failed attempted abortion O07.2
  • embolism complicating induced abortion O04.7
  • embolism complicating spontaneous abortion O03.2 O03.7
